面向电力系统实时通信的应用层数据网关模型的设计

摘    要:本文针对电力系统采用不同应用层协议通信,阻碍信息交换与共享的现状,提出一种面向电力系统实时通信的应用层数据网关模型。该模型成功地实现了信息在不同应用层协议间的传递、将分布在不同调度系统的实时数据及非实时数据通过远程网络统一管理起来。

Application-Layer Gateway Model Design for Realtime Communication in Power Supply Systems

Abstract:A lot of application layer protocols have been adopted for communication in power supply systems, which hindered in formation exchanging and sharing among stations and dispatch centers. This paper presents an application layer gateway model for realtime communication in power supply systems. It enables efficient information transmission among different application layer protocols so that all realtime data from distributed dispatch systems as well as non-realtime data are managed as a whole through the remote network.
